macros पर टैग किए गए जवाब

*** VBA / MS-Office भाषाओं के लिए उपयोग न करें। इसके बजाय संबंधित [vba] टैग का उपयोग करें। *** एक मैक्रो एक नियम या पैटर्न है जो निर्दिष्ट करता है कि कैसे एक निश्चित इनपुट अनुक्रम (अक्सर वर्णों का अनुक्रम) को आउटपुट अनुक्रम (अक्सर वर्णों के अनुक्रम) के अनुसार मैप किया जाना चाहिए एक निर्धारित प्रक्रिया।

14
मैं संकलन-समय पर एक # मूल्य का मूल्य कैसे दिखाऊं?
मैं यह जानने की कोशिश कर रहा हूं कि मेरे कोड के कौन से संस्करण का उपयोग करने के बारे में सोचता है। मैं कुछ इस तरह करना चाहता हूं: #error BOOST_VERSION लेकिन प्रीप्रोसेसर BOOST_VERSION का विस्तार नहीं करता है। मुझे पता है कि मैं इसे प्रोग्राम से रन-टाइम पर …

9
क्या ग्रहण के लिए मैक्रो रिकॉर्डर है? [बन्द है]
बन्द है। यह प्रश्न स्टैक ओवरफ्लो दिशानिर्देशों को पूरा नहीं करता है । यह वर्तमान में उत्तर स्वीकार नहीं कर रहा है। इस प्रश्न को सुधारना चाहते हैं? सवाल को अपडेट करें ताकि यह स्टैक ओवरफ्लो के लिए ऑन-टॉपिक हो । 6 साल पहले बंद हुआ । इस प्रश्न को …
115 java  eclipse  ide  editor  macros 

4
प्रीप्रोसेसर मैक्रोज़ से प्लेटफ़ॉर्म / कंपाइलर की पहचान कैसे करें?
मैं एक क्रॉस-प्लेटफ़ॉर्म कोड लिख रहा हूं, जिसे लिनक्स, विंडोज़, मैक ओएस पर संकलित करना चाहिए। खिड़कियों पर, मुझे दृश्य स्टूडियो और मिंगव का समर्थन करना चाहिए। प्लेटफ़ॉर्म-विशिष्ट कोड के कुछ टुकड़े हैं, जिन्हें मुझे #ifdef .. #endifपर्यावरण में रखना चाहिए । उदाहरण के लिए, यहां मैंने win32 विशिष्ट कोड …


3
क्लैंग का पता लगाने के लिए मैं किस पूर्वनिर्धारित मैक्रो का उपयोग कर सकता हूं?
मैं अपने स्रोत कोड को संकलित करने के लिए उपयोग किए गए कंपाइलर का पता लगाने की कोशिश कर रहा हूं। मैं आसानी से पूर्वनिर्धारित मैक्रोज़ को MSVC या GCC के लिए देख सकता हूं (देखें) उदाहरण के लिए http://predef.sourceforge.net/ ) के लिए सकता हूं, लेकिन मुझे क्लैग की जांच …

13
IOS मैक्रो द्वारा iPhone X, iPhone 6 प्लस, iPhone 6, iPhone 5, iPhone 4 का पता कैसे लगाएं?
मैक्रो द्वारा डिवाइस मॉडल का पता कैसे लगाएं? मैं इस तरह से कुछ का उपयोग कर रहा था, लेकिन सिम्युलेटर alway IS_IPHONE_5 पर परिणाम #define IS_IPAD (UI_USER_INTERFACE_IDIOM() == UIUserInterfaceIdiomPad) #define IS_IPHONE (UI_USER_INTERFACE_IDIOM() == UIUserInterfaceIdiomPhone) #define IS_IPHONE_5 (IS_IPHONE && [[UIScreen mainScreen] bounds].size.height == 568.0) #define IS_IPHONE_6 (IS_IPHONE && [[UIScreen mainScreen] bounds].size.height …
111 iphone  macros  detect 

9
मैं डिग्री से रेडियन में कैसे बदल सकता हूं?
मैं इस Obj-Cकोड को Swiftकोड में बदलने की कोशिश कर रहा हूं, लेकिन मुझे नहीं पता कि इस कोड के बराबर क्या होना चाहिए? #define DEGREES_TO_RADIANS(degrees)((M_PI * degrees)/180) मैंने गुगली की और यह पाया लेकिन मुझे समझ नहीं आ रहा है कि मेरे मामले में स्विफ्ट में कैसे परिवर्तित किया …
107 ios  objective-c  macos  swift  macros 

19
C मैक्रो की परिभाषा बड़े एंडियन या छोटे एंडियन मशीन को निर्धारित करने के लिए?
क्या मशीन की समाप्ति का निर्धारण करने के लिए एक पंक्ति मैक्रो परिभाषा है। मैं निम्नलिखित कोड का उपयोग कर रहा हूं, लेकिन इसे मैक्रो में परिवर्तित करना बहुत लंबा होगा। unsigned char test_endian( void ) { int test_var = 1; unsigned char *test_endian = (unsigned char*)&test_var; return (test_endian[0] == …

2
# मै और __LINE__ के साथ सी मैक्रो बनाना (पोजिशनिंग मैक्रो के साथ टोकन कॉन्कैटैनेशन)
मैं एक सी मैक्रो बनाना चाहता हूं जो लाइन नंबर के आधार पर नाम के साथ एक फ़ंक्शन बनाता है। मुझे लगा कि मैं कुछ कर सकता हूं (वास्तविक कार्य में ब्रेस के भीतर कथन होंगे): #define UNIQUE static void Unique_##__LINE__(void) {} मुझे उम्मीद थी कि इसका विस्तार कुछ इस …
107 c  macros  concatenation  token 

6
"स्रोत" कमांड लाइन तर्क (-D) से C स्रोत कोड तक मैक्रो परिभाषा कैसे पास करें?
मैं आमतौर पर विकल्प का उपयोग करते हुए "मेक लाइन" से "मेकफाइल" तक मैक्रो परिभाषाओं को पास करता हूं: -डैम = मान। परिभाषा मेकफिल के अंदर उपलब्ध है। मैं इसी तरह के संकलक विकल्प का उपयोग करके "मेकफाइल" से "स्रोत कोड" तक मैक्रो परिभाषाओं को भी पास करता हूं: -Dname …
107 c  macros  makefile 


7
सी / सी ++ मैक्रो में कोमा
कहें कि हमारे पास इस तरह एक मैक्रो है #define FOO(type,name) type name जिसे हम इस्तेमाल कर सकते थे FOO(int, int_var); लेकिन हमेशा बस के रूप में नहीं: FOO(std::map<int, int>, map_var); // error: macro "FOO" passed 3 arguments, but takes just 2 बेशक हम कर सकते हैं: typedef std::map<int, int> …
103 c++  c  macros  c-preprocessor 

15
C ++ में __CLASS__ मैक्रो है?
क्या __CLASS__C ++ में एक मैक्रो है जो क्लास को __FUNCTION__मैक्रो के समान नाम देता है जो फ़ंक्शन का नाम देता है
100 c++  macros 

4
स्विफ्ट: एपीआई कुंजियों को लागू करने के लिए PREPROCESSOR झंडे (जैसे # # DEBUG`) का उपयोग कैसे करें?
में Objective-Cयह कभी कभी वैकल्पिक API कुंजियां (उदाहरण के लिए अंतर करने के लिए छोड़ दें और डीबग चाबियाँ के बीच विश्लेषण पैकेज के लिए, Mixpanel, घबराहट या Crashlytics) की तरह परिभाषित करने के लिए स्थिर स्ट्रिंग स्थिरांक उपयोग करने के लिए उपयोगी था: #if DEBUG static NSString *const API_KEY …

3
कॉन्स्ट्रेक्स बनाम मैक्रोज़
मुझे मैक्रोज़ का उपयोग करना कहां पसंद करना चाहिए और मुझे कॉन्स्ट्रेक्स कहां पसंद करना चाहिए ? वे मूल रूप से एक ही नहीं हैं? #define MAX_HEIGHT 720 बनाम constexpr unsigned int max_height = 720;
95 c++  c++11  macros  constexpr 

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.